If the free tier of ADB AppControl does not meet your needs and you strictly require advanced features without paying, do not turn to cracks. Instead, utilize safe, open-source alternatives that are entirely free: Universal Android Debloater (UAD):

A highly popular, community-driven graphical interface. It is entirely free and designed specifically to help you remove carrier and OEM bloatware safely. It features massive, documented lists telling you exactly what is safe to delete and what will break your phone. Direct ADB via Terminal:

If you are willing to learn a few text commands, you can download the official Google SDK Platform-Tools and use the terminal. To uninstall an app: adb shell pm uninstall --user 0 To disable an app: adb shell pm disable-user --user 0 💎 Supporting the Developer Get Extended - ADB AppControl

If you aren't ready to buy a key yet, you can still get amazing results using the base version plus a little manual effort: 1. Use Official "Debloat Lists"

The Extended version automates debloating, but you can do it manually for free. Visit forums like XDA Developers and search for "Safe to Debloat List" for your specific phone model. You can then use the standard ADB AppControl search bar to find and disable those specific packages. 2. Manual Backup via ADB

While the Extended version simplifies APK extraction, the base version still allows you to manage apps. If you need to back up an APK, you can use the command line adb pull command alongside the tool to get the files you need without a key. 3. Watch for Giveaways

While searching for "free activation keys" often leads to risky sites, you can enjoy a better, safer experience by focusing on these powerful built-in features that don't require a premium license: 1. Advanced Bloatware Removal

The core strength of ADB AppControl is the ability to disable or uninstall system apps that your phone normally won't let you touch. It includes a "Basic" and "Extended" debloat list to help you identify what is safe to remove without bricking your device. 2. Screen Mirroring & Remote Control

You can view and control your Android screen directly from your PC. This is perfect for: Navigating apps with a mouse and keyboard.

Taking high-quality screenshots or recording your screen without watermarks. Managing your device if the physical screen is damaged. 3. Bulk .APK Installer & Manager

Instead of installing apps one by one, you can drag and drop a dozen .apk files into the window to install them simultaneously. It also allows you to save (export) any app already on your phone back to your PC as a backup. 4. Permission & Activity Management

You can modify app permissions (like forcing an app to stay awake or revoking tracking) and launch specific "hidden" activities within apps that aren't usually accessible from the standard UI. 5. Multi-Device Support

Even in the free version, you can quickly toggle between different connected devices (phones, tablets, or Fire TV sticks) to apply the same debloating scripts or app installs across all of them.

What is ADB?

ADB is a command-line tool that allows developers to communicate with Android devices. It enables you to perform various actions, such as installing APKs, running shell commands, and controlling app behavior.

App Control with ADB

ADB provides several commands to control app behavior on an Android device. Here are a few examples:

  1. Listing installed packages: adb shell pm list packages
  2. Installing an APK: adb install -r /path/to/your/app.apk
  3. Uninstalling an app: adb uninstall package_name
  4. Force-stopping an app: adb shell am force-stop package_name
  5. Clearing app data: adb shell pm clear package_name
